Temperature
These controls are used to individually set the temperature for both sides of the passenger compartment. Please note
that the compartment will not be heated or cooled faster by setting the temperature higher or lower than necessary.
Set the control to the temperature you prefer.
Defroster
This function defrosts/de-ices the windshield and front side windows. The LED in the switch will light up to indicate
that the defrost function is engaged.
Blower speed increases automatically and the air conditioning will switch on (if not already on and if the passenger
compartment blower is not turned off) to dehumidify the air in the passenger compartment.
Recirculation will not function while defrost is engaged.
The climate system will return to its previous settings when the defroster function is switched off.
Blower control
Turn the control clockwise to increase or counterclockwise to decrease the blower speed. Pressing the AUTO switch
will automatically regulate blower speed and override manual adjustment.
Turning the blower control counterclockwise until an orange LED comes on will turn both the blower and the air
conditioning off.
Air distribution

Electronic climate control, ECC
Heated front seats (option)
Press the switch once for maximum seat heating. Both LEDs in the switch will be lit.
Press the switch a second time for comfort heating. One LED in the switch will be lit.
Press the switch a third time to turn the heating off completely. The LED will go off.
The seat heating for the passenger seat should be switched off when the seat is not occupied.
A/C - ON/OFF
Press the switch to turn the air conditioning on or off. The "ON" or "OFF" LED will light up to indicate if the system
is switched on or off. Other functions will still be regulated automatically (if the AUTO switch is on).
The air conditioning functions only at temperatures above 32 °F (0 °C).
While the Defroster function is selected, the air conditioning is temporarily activated to dehumidify the air, even if
you have manually switched the air conditioning off. This will only function if the blower is not switched off.
Recirculation
Press this switch to engage the recirculation function (air in the passenger compartment recirculates - no fresh air
enters the compartment). The LED in the switch will light up to indicate that the function is engaged.
Use this function if the outside air is contaminated with exhaust gases, smoke, etc or to heat/cool the vehicle
quickly.
Recirculation should not be used for more than 15 minutes. If your windows begin to fog or mist, make sure that the

recirculation function is switched off.
Selecting Defroster automatically switches recirculation off.
Timer mode activation: (vehicles with the Interior Air Quality system have no timer mode) Press and hold the
recirculation button for at least 3 seconds to activate a recirculation timer mode. The amber LED in the recirculation
button will flash 5 times to show that the timer mode is being activated. In timer mode, each time the recirculation
button is pressed, the climate control system will recirculate the air in the passenger compartment for 5-12 minutes,
depending on the outside air temperature, and then revert back to fresh air.
Timer mode deactivation: Press and hold the recirculation button for 3 seconds. The amber LED in the recirculation
button will illuminate steadily for 5 seconds to show a return to "normal" mode.
In normal mode, when the recirculation button is pressed, the climate control system will recirculate the air in the
passenger compartment until the recirculation button is pressed again.
Timer mode memory: If the vehicle is turned off while timer mode is active, timer mode will still be active when
the vehicle is restarted.
Interior air quality sensor (option)
Some vehicles are equipped with a multifilter and air quality sensor. The filter separates gases and particles, thereby
reducing the amounts of odors and contaminants entering the vehicle. The air quality sensor detects increased levels of
contaminants in the outside air. When the air quality sensor detects
89 03 Climate
Electronic climate control, ECC
contaminated outside air, the air intake closes and the air inside the passenger compartment is recirculated, i.e. no
outside air enters the vehicle. The filter also cleans recirculated passenger compartment air.

Interior lighting
Reading lights and courtesy light
1. Driver's side front reading lamp
2. Courtesy lights
3. Passenger's side front reading lamp
The reading lights can be switched on or off by pressing buttons 1 or 3.
The courtesy lighting (including footwell lighting) can be turned on or off by pressing button 2. This also activates the
automatic function.
ProCarManuals.com
Page 90 of 230

4. Driver's side rear reading light
5. Passenger's side rear reading light
The rear reading lights can be switched on and off by pressing buttons 4 or 5.
Automatic function
The reading lights and courtesy lights will switch off automatically approximately 10 minutes after the engine has been
turned off. The lights can be turned off sooner by pressing the respective buttons.
The courtesy lights come on automatically
1 and remain on for approximately 30 seconds when:
The vehicle has been unlocked from the outside with the remote control or key
If the engine has been switched off and the ignition key has been turned to position 0
The courtesy lights will come on and remain on for approximately 10 minutes when:
One of the doors is opened (assuming the courtesy lighting has not previously been switched off)
The courtesy lighting will go off when:
The engine is started
The vehicle is locked from the outside with the remote control or key
The automatic function can be disconnected by pressing button 2 for more than 3 seconds.
Briefly pressing the button again automatically reconnects the function.
The courtesy light timer periods can be changed. Contact a trained and qualified Volvo service technician.
1This function is light dependent and is only activated in dark conditions.

Rear seat and trunk
Folding the rear seat backrest
ProCarManuals.com
Page 96 of 230

The center backrest cushion folds forward, allowing you to transport long, light cargo such as skis in the trunk of your
vehicle. To lower the backrest:
1. Pull the right release control handle in the trunk to release the backrest (see page 103
).
2. From the rear seat, fold down the right section of the backrest slightly.
3. Release the flap by pushing the catch (located on the rear side of the backrest) upward and pulling the flap forward.
4. Return the backrest to the upright position.
The cover on the rear seat armrest does not have hinges and should be removed before the ski hatch is used.
To remove:
1. Open the cover approximately 30°.
2. Pull it straight up.
To put in place:
1. Press the cover into the groove behind the upholstery.
2. Close the cover.
